Art By Gary Harbour

Gary's Scrimshaw is all hand-etched. No Machinery is used in the art process. He works on ivory such as mastadon and mammoth. He does not deal with anyone who may illegally harvest ivory. He also creates scrimshaw in color and black and white on bone stag.

Gary is one of the few scrimshanders in the world able to work on the hard surface of mother-of pearl.

Each piece is one of a kind.

Gary is a national award-winning artist who got his start as a young child and encouragement from Norman Rockwell who gifted him with his first set of oil paints. Gary was introduced to scrimshaw as a young man when he met and admired the work of a New Bedford scrimshander at a local Vermont exhibition.

His work has been collected for many years throughout the world
